Newcastle ‘make contact with former Arsenal and Liverpool transfer target Nabil Fekir’ over January transfer

NEWLY rich Newcastle are ready to splash their cash with a January move for Nabil Fekir.
The 28-year-old was previously on the verge of a move to Liverpool in 2018, and has also been linked with Arsenal in the past.
According to footmercato, contact has already been made between the Magpies and representatives of the Frenchman.
But now the Real Betis midfielder is attracting interest from Newcastle's mega-rich Saudi owners.
Betis are eager to tie Fekir down to a new bumper contract following his cut-price £18million move switch from Lyon in 2019.
His current deal expires at the end of next season and the Andalusians want Fekir to put pen-to-paper on an extension to avoid losing him for a small fee.
Fekir himself has down-played rumours linking him with a move away, but has not completely close the door on a move to Tyneside.
He admitted to Betis TV: "You never know in football, but the truth is that today, I do not think of the other offers. I am at Betis and I am very happy here."

Fekir is not the only star linked with a January move to Newcastle.
Struggling Chelsea man Timo Werner has also been touted as a potential signing.
The Magpies are rumoured to be 'in regular contact' with the striker's agent as they prepare to splash the cash.
Steve Bruce's side are now the richest club in world football - worth a staggering £320BILLION.
And SunSport exclusively revealed last week that Amanda Staveley has promised the Toon Army “world-class” players.
Joint-owner Staveley claimed: “We are in the market to compete for world-class players.
“We have great ambitions — I hope it’s going to be a game changer for Newcastle United.
"But if you don’t put the infrastructure around that world-class player and you don’t have a team that can play with him, you’ll get nowhere.”
